The Korea Times reported today that the Ministry of Health and Welfare has decided to scrap HIV tests for foreigners "seeking to acquire an entertainer's E-6 visa, and workers renewing their E-9 visas." It goes on to say that "...the tests will still be reuqired of those seeking E-2 language teaching visas."
That's right. They've done away with HIV tests for everyone except for teachers.
